Under the ‘Inclusive Education’ Act all schools are responsible for providing a suitable learning place for every child

If the support required turns out to be too specialised or intensive, the child might be referred to a dedicated special needs school. There are different types of special needs education based on the type of special needs. At these schools the class sizes are smaller than at regular schools, and the children receive more tailor-made and specialised support and therapies focused on their specific needs. The teachers teach at different levels in the class, and most children follow the regular curriculum.
